PWA course in which we are going to learn how to create our own progressive web apps compatible with WordPress.

Progressive Web Applications or PWAs are web applications that can be installed on any operating system, whether mobile or desktop, through a web browser. Over the last few years its use has spread and now any modern web browser supports the technology to run these types of applications.

All this from scratch to be able to assimilate all the necessary knowledge to be a PWA master and make our WordPress sites shine. The idea of ​​the course is that throughout the different lessons we are going to apply the knowledge learned to go deeper little by little in how to develop PWAs to finally develop our PWA with WordPress.

We will start with the most basic: what is a PWA? We will see its origin and history to put some context of who is behind it and how this technology has evolved. Once we have the context, we will see how it works and the characteristics that make this type of application so special thanks to service workers. Next we will see the internal structure of a PWA and we will configure our first compatible manifest. It is very important to understand the data flow between the different files involved in the final operation of the PWA, especially the service workers.

It is important that we analyze the manifest well, since it is basically the file where all the information and configuration of our PWA is centralized. From here we will see our first “Hello world” example.

With all this well-established knowledge, we will get fully involved in turning our WordPress into a PWA. We will see how to optimize the templates so that they work optimally in the application, as well as a series of plugins that will allow us to transform our site into a PWA compatible with all web browsers and operating systems.

Finally the last lessons will be the development of notifications, testing of the application and configuration. Without a doubt, this course is very interesting if you want to learn how to convert your WordPress projects to PWA.

We must bear in mind that to take the course you will need basic knowledge of WordPress, HTML, CSS and Javascript in order to understand some issues and program, but don’t worry because at .com you have courses on all this to complete your online experience .
